Vinyl is available in a variety of styles and types. Home and Gardens write in their article, "Luxury vinyl is made up of multiple layers of vinyl, and is thus thicker, more durable and more expensive. Its rigidity means that it is largely available as tiles (LVT) or planks (LVP) and has a more convincing appearance when emulating natural materials. It can also be clicked together at the sides, rather than stuck down with glue." However, Sheet vinyl is the most common due to its affordability and ease of installation. This type of flooring can be installed as one continuous piece for a cohesive look.
If moisture or dampness is an unavoidable part of your home or business, then vinyl sheet flooring should be a top choice. Think bathrooms and mudrooms; these are the perfect places to install this material.

When selecting vinyl flooring in Austin, Tx, it is important to understand the various thickness options available and which one works best for your space.
• Grade 1 vinyl offers the most protection from wear and tear as well as heavy foot traffic – making this option perfect for high-traffic areas in your home or business.
• Grade 2 will perform admirably with moderate use.
• Grade 3 has just enough thickness needed to handle any light traffic zones.

When it comes to picking out the perfect vinyl flooring for your home, there are a few key factors to consider. First and foremost, the color of your flooring should ideally match or complement other elements in the room, such as wall colors or furniture. You will also want to think about texture and pattern; if you're aiming for a subtle look, opt for a basic pattern like wood grain in low gloss.
For more statement-making floors, consider high-gloss tiles with intricate, geometric patterns. Different textures can also bring their unique twist, so be sure to test it out by running your fingers across samples before purchasing. Doing your research ahead of time will help ensure that you pick the right option that meets both your aesthetic and practical needs.
